Rare Nevada Opal Carving of an Octopus
Virgin Valley, Denio, Nevada
By Ronald Stevens
Evoking frothing waves of the sea, a jelly-like specimen of Nevada opal was utilized in this carving depicting an octopus. Smoky brown hues intermingle with midnight blue to light gray and a splash of orange at the edge--it is rare to see a carving made of this precious material.
Measures 5 x 3.5 x 3.0mm
